AI eavesdropped on whale chatter. It may have helped find something new

Some sperm whale “clicks” could be “clacks,” but what that could mean is controversial

Three giant gray sperm whales swim just under the surface of the ocean.

Sperm whales communicate using clicking sounds called codas. AI tools helped reveal a new aspect to this sound, though whether different versions of a coda actually mean different things to the whales remains to be seen.
